Transaction 55f580158112ab5e4b7bced32fe25679258ef4b2a3ab81d144b4529f2b6de01a

2 Input
2 Outputs
  • 55f580158112ab5e4b7bced32fe25679258ef4b2a3ab81d144b4529f2b6de01a:0
  • value  616894
    address  1a9ePaTk1hjvM9mg1VF3UvK1xqA3rBFuW
  • 55f580158112ab5e4b7bced32fe25679258ef4b2a3ab81d144b4529f2b6de01a:1
  • value  1181313
    address  12ZK56ggebf2yZrihkQstcHSeKcHFXjaKB